Add a little warm water to a shallow bowl and mix in about a half tsp of table salt. Stir the salt in till it dissolves. Grab one of those outlawed q-tips and get to dipping into the saline solution. Use this solution to wash around the piercing on the front and back. WebMany relatively minor issues can cause a smell behind the ears. You need a small and clean rag to place your earrings and some cotton balls or swabs. Once you have this, you can dip the cotton swab into the cleaning agent and wipe the earring backs. Do not forget to wipe any buildup in the holes of the earring backs with the disinfectant.
